Transaction 80e0562bb298500d466c9afe420d8a7f08026dce44ed1c5ae6b0817a9db48d46
1 Input
2 Outputs
- 80e0562bb298500d466c9afe420d8a7f08026dce44ed1c5ae6b0817a9db48d46:0
- 80e0562bb298500d466c9afe420d8a7f08026dce44ed1c5ae6b0817a9db48d46:1
value 21913695
address 12wFkWAwugjR5ibhnpt6dAWbWrTQHh59fm
value 106186901442
address 3HR15PkSN7GdVHxBv53c6Tqx4oxHoYfYx2